VibeVoice-Realtime-0.5B is a compact real-time voice synthesis model engineered for low‑resource environments. It leverages a parameter count of 0.5 billion to deliver ultra‑low latency while preserving natural prosody. The model supports a context window of up to 10 seconds, enabling fluid conversational flow. Its architecture incorporates attention‑free mechanisms that cut computational overhead and power usage. Developers can integrate the model via a lightweight API that provides high‑fidelity audio output at a sample rate of 48 kHz.
| Parameter Count | 0.5 B |
| Context Length | 10 s |
| Sample Rate | 48 kHz |
| Latency | <10 ms |
| Supported Languages | EN, ES, FR, DE |
